How to add a row
 

Hey all...

I have a simple question... hoping someone might know the answer.

I need to insert a row after every unique cell (the column is sorted)
in a specific column.

The data starts in B4 and goes down an undetermined amount of rows
(data is always being added / deleted)... all I want to do is to add a
row after every 'group' in that column B.

I've tried Loops combined with If statements with no luck...

How to add a row
 
NeedsExcelHelp4, here is one way,

Sub Insert_Row_In_ColumnB()
'insert 1 rows in column B, when data changes
Dim Number_of_rows As Long
Dim Rowinsert As Integer
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Number_of_rows = Range("B65536").End(xlUp).Row
Rowinsert = 1
Range("B2").Select
Do Until Selection.Row = Number_of_rows + 1
If Selection.Value < Selection.Offset(-1, 0).Value Then
Selection.EntireRow.Resize(Rowinsert).Insert
Number_of_rows = Number_of_rows + Rowinsert
Selection.Offset(Rowinsert + 1, 0).Select
Else
Selection.Offset(1, 0).Select
End If
Loop
Application.ScreenUpdating = True
End Sub

How to add a row
 
Since you wanted to start in B4, did you change

Range("B2").Select
to
Range("B5").Select

did that help?

if not

What is the error? Is it a type mismatch error?

Do you have any error values in your cells in column B?

Are you using xl97?

Where is the selection when you get the error
